如何用3个步骤彻底解决聊天记录撤回的终极方案:RevokeMsgPatcher深度指南
【免费下载链接】RevokeMsgPatcher:tr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了)项目地址: https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her
你是否经历过这样的场景:同事发来的重要工作安排突然消失,客户的需求说明在撤回后无法确认,或者朋友分享的有趣消息还没来得及看就变成了"对方已撤回一条消息"?在数字化沟通成为主流的今天,消息撤回功能虽然保护了发送方的隐私,却给接收方带来了信息缺失的困扰。RevokeMsgPatcher正是为解决这一痛点而生,这款专业的Windows平台防撤回工具,让你从此告别重要信息丢失的烦恼,真正掌握聊天记录的主动权。
想象一下,你的电脑里有一位隐形的数字保镖,每当有人试图撤回发给你的消息时,这位保镖会悄悄拦截删除指令,同时让对方以为撤回成功。这就是RevokeMsgPatcher的工作原理——通过智能的二进制修改技术,在不影响软件正常使用的前提下,实现对微信、QQ、TIM等主流通讯软件的完美防撤回支持。
第一步:为什么选择RevokeMsgPatcher而不是其他方案?
在寻找防撤回解决方案时,你可能遇到过各种方法:手动截图、第三方备份工具、甚至复杂的脚本配置。但这些方案都存在明显的局限性:
| 解决方案 | 实时性 | 完整性 | 易用性 | 稳定性 |
|---|---|---|---|---|
| 手动截图 | 需要预判 | 容易遗漏 | 操作繁琐 | 依赖人工 |
| 备份工具 | 延迟备份 | 可能包含已撤回内容 | 配置复杂 | 占用资源 |
| 脚本方案 | 实时性高 | 完整保留 | 技术门槛高 | 兼容性差 |
| RevokeMsgPatcher | 实时拦截 | 100%保留 | 一键操作 | 稳定可靠 |
RevokeMsgPatcher的核心优势在于它的"原位保护"理念。与那些需要额外存储空间或复杂配置的方案不同,它直接在应用的二进制层面工作,就像给软件安装了一个隐形的过滤器,只拦截特定的删除指令,而不改变消息的原始存储位置。
第二步:揭秘RevokeMsgPatcher如何成为你的数字保镖
工作原理:二进制层面的智能拦截
你可能好奇,一个简单的工具是如何对抗复杂的撤回机制的?让我用一个生活中的比喻来解释:想象你的聊天记录就像放在书架上的书,撤回功能就像是有人想从你的书架上偷偷拿走一本书。传统的方法是在书架旁安装摄像头(截图),或者把书复制一份放在别处(备份)。而RevokeMsgPatcher的做法更巧妙——它在书架上安装了一个隐形的保护罩,当有人试图拿书时,保护罩会立即启动,让对方以为书已经被拿走,实际上书还好好地留在原处。
具体到技术实现,RevokeMsgPatcher采用了专业的逆向工程技术。它会分析目标应用的核心文件,比如微信的WeChatWin.dll或QQ的IM.dll,寻找处理撤回指令的关键代码段。通过修改这些代码的逻辑判断,将"如果收到撤回指令则删除消息"改为"收到撤回指令时返回成功但不执行删除"。
上图展示了工具如何通过搜索"revokemsg"等关键词,在微信的二进制文件中定位到撤回相关的函数。这个过程就像是侦探在复杂的代码迷宫中寻找特定的线索,一旦找到关键位置,就能实施精准的"手术"。
精准修补:改变指令而不破坏功能
找到目标代码后,RevokeMsgPatcher会进行精密的二进制修改。这些修改通常是微小的指令调整,比如将条件跳转指令(JE)改为无条件跳转(JMP),或者修改函数调用的返回值。这些修改虽然微小,却能从根本上改变撤回指令的执行逻辑。
这张图片展示了工具应用补丁的界面。你可以看到具体的修改内容,比如将某个地址的指令从"74"改为"EB",这代表将条件跳转改为无条件跳转。整个过程就像外科医生进行微创手术,只改变必要的部分,不影响其他功能的正常运行。
第三步:5分钟快速部署实战指南
环境准备:确保一切就绪
开始之前,你需要确认几个必要条件:
- 操作系统:Windows 7或更高版本(不支持XP)
- 运行环境:安装.NET Framework 4.5.2或更新版本
- 权限准备:确保能以管理员身份运行程序
💡小贴士:如果不知道如何检查.NET Framework版本,可以在命令提示符中输入reg query "H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\NET Framework Setup\NDP\v4\Full" /v Release来查看。
实战操作:一步步完成保护部署
准备工作:
- 完全退出需要保护的应用(微信、QQ或TIM)
- 暂时关闭杀毒软件(它们可能误判二进制修改)
- 从官方仓库获取工具:
git clone https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her
操作流程:
- 启动工具:进入下载的目录,右键点击"RevokeMsgPatcher.exe",选择"以管理员身份运行"
- 自动检测:工具会自动扫描系统,识别已安装的通讯软件
- 选择应用:在界面中勾选需要保护的应用
- 应用补丁:点击"防撤回"按钮,等待处理完成
验证效果:
- 重新启动微信/QQ/TIM
- 让朋友发送一条测试消息并撤回
- 检查你的聊天窗口是否仍然显示完整消息
常见问题与解决方案
问题1:应用补丁后软件无法启动👉解决方案:使用工具的"紧急恢复"功能,选择对应应用的"恢复原始文件"选项。如果问题依旧,可以尝试使用"版本适配"功能选择旧版补丁。
问题2:软件更新后防撤回功能失效👉解决方案:这是正常现象,因为软件更新会替换被修改的文件。只需重新运行RevokeMsgPatcher,点击"重新应用补丁"即可。
问题3:多账号登录时保护不生效👉解决方案:在工具的"高级设置"中启用"多账号支持"选项。如果使用微信分身等工具,需要为每个分身单独应用补丁。
进阶技巧:让保护效果最大化
多开功能:一机多号的完美方案
除了防撤回,RevokeMsgPatcher还集成了实用的多开功能。想象一下,你可以同时登录工作微信和个人微信,或者管理多个业务账号,而不需要频繁切换登录。
使用方法:
- 在主界面勾选"多开功能"选项
- 应用补丁后,直接双击微信图标即可启动多个实例
- 每个实例都是独立的,互不干扰
自定义保护规则
通过工具的设置界面,你可以进一步定制保护行为:
- 消息类型过滤:选择只保护文字消息,或者包括图片、文件等
- 例外群组设置:对特定聊天群不启用防撤回功能
- 自动更新监控:开启后工具会自动检测软件更新并提醒重新应用补丁
定期健康检查
建议每周进行一次简单的健康检查:
- 运行RevokeMsgPatcher
- 点击"版本检测"查看当前补丁状态
- 如果显示"软件已更新",点击"重新应用补丁"
安全与责任:正确使用防撤回工具
隐私保护边界
虽然RevokeMsgPatcher让你能够保留被撤回的消息,但使用时仍需注意:
- 尊重他人隐私:不要滥用工具窥探他人撤回的内容
- 合法合规使用:仅用于个人重要信息留存,不用于非法目的
- 明确告知义务:在重要对话中,可以告知对方你使用了防撤回功能
数据���全考虑
工具在设计时就充分考虑了安全性:
- 不收集任何用户数据:所有操作都在本地完成
- 自动备份原始文件:应用补丁前会自动备份,可随时恢复
- 开源透明:代码完全开源,接受社区监督
最佳实践:让工具为你服务
工作场景应用
对于职场人士,RevokeMsgPatcher可以成为重要的生产力工具:
- 会议纪要保护:确保重要的会议安排和决策不被误撤回
- 客户需求确认:保留客户的所有需求说明,避免理解偏差
- 项目进度跟踪:完整记录项目讨论,便于追溯和复盘
个人生活使用
在日常生活中,工具同样能发挥重要作用:
- 重要约定留存:朋友聚会的具体安排不再因撤回而模糊
- 情感交流记录:保留那些温暖的话语,让美好不被删除
- 学习资料收集:群聊中的有用信息可以完整保存
技术原理深度解析:逆向工程的智慧
如果你对技术细节感兴趣,RevokeMsgPatcher的实现原理体现了逆向工程的精妙之处。工具通过分析目标应用的二进制文件,寻找特定的字符串特征和函数调用模式,然后应用精确的二进制补丁。
上图展示了工具对QQ程序进行逆向分析的过程。通过分析反汇编代码,工具能够定位到处理消息撤回的关键函数,然后应用相应的补丁。这种方法的优势在于它不依赖于特定的API或版本号,而是基于二进制特征进行识别,因此具有更好的兼容性。
常见误区澄清
误区1:使用防撤回工具会违反软件使用协议👉事实:防撤回工具只是修改本地文件,不涉及服务器端操作,也不破解付费功能。它类似于自定义皮肤或插件,属于个人使用范畴。
误区2:防撤回工具会导致账号被封👉事实:工具只修改本地文件,不会向服务器发送异常请求。多年使用经验表明,正确使用不会导致账号问题。
误区3:每次软件更新都需要重新安装系统👉事实:只需重新运行RevokeMsgPatcher应用补丁即可,整个过程不超过2分钟。
未来展望:持续进化与社区贡献
RevokeMsgPatcher作为一个开源项目,其生命力来自社区的持续贡献。随着微信、QQ等软件的不断更新,工具也在持续进化,保持对新版本的兼容性。
社区参与方式:
- 反馈问题:在使用中遇到问题,可以在项目仓库提交Issue
- 贡献代码:如果你是开发者,可以参与代码改进和功能开发
- 分享经验:在社区中分享你的使用技巧和最佳实践
开始你的防撤回之旅
现在,你已经全面了解了RevokeMsgPatcher的强大功能和简单使用方法。是时候告别那些因消息撤回而带来的遗憾了。记住,技术的价值在于让生活更美好,而RevokeMsgPatcher正是这样一个让数字沟通更加完整、更加可靠的工具。
最后的小建议:第一次使用时,建议先在一个不重要的账号上进行测试,熟悉操作流程后再应用到主要账号。这样既能确保操作正确,也能让你更放心地享受完整聊天记录带来的便利。
选择RevokeMsgPatcher,就是选择对重要信息的主动保护。在这个信息瞬息万变的时代,给自己一个留住重要记忆的机会。毕竟,有些消息一旦错过,可能就永远错过了。
【免费下载链接】RevokeMsgPatcher:tr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了)项目地址: https://gitcode.com/GitHub_Trending/re/RevokeMsgPatc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考